Reflecting back on AS year: what I learned about music videos

 At the end of the AS year I discovered that music videos were in some ways incredibly different than movies and dramas and in others rather similar. Music videos use certain symbols known as generic signifiers to announce the genre of the video; so this means that all Hip Pop videos will feature women, expensive cars and aesthetics and the imagery of wealth and money. Another signifier I discovered for the genre of any video is that bands and groups tend to dress similarly to each other which helps to promote them individually while still showing that they are a unit.

 Within mainstream videos the use of branding is another major generic signifier as they help create a sense of familiarity among viewers while at the same time they draw attention to the genre.

 I also discovered that music videos are filled with special effects and a variety of shot types; they range from use of slow motion and flashes to close-ups on the singers faces.
